Pastoral education
conference ongoing

AT SILLIMAN

Around 30 clinical pastoral education practitioners and students from the Visayas and Mindanao are participating in the 5th CPE regional convention until today at the Silliman University Divinity School in Dumaguete City, a press release from organizers said.

The convention, on the theme “Giving Voice into the Journey Towards Wellness”, includes discussions on the nature, roles and challenges of CPE, and an immersion session at the Talay Mental Rehabilitation Center in Dumaguete City today, the press release also said.

Resource speakers are Lourdino Yuzon, former dean of the Divinity School; Krypton Kho, a neurosurgeon at the SU Medical Center; Fr. Geremvit Truno of the St. Joseph Seminary; and former university pastor Mediador Jumawan, the press release added.*
